-module(livery_access_log). -moduledoc """ Access-log middleware. Emits one structured log entry per completed request via the OTP `logger` module. Pairs cleanly with `livery_request_id`: the id is included in the entry so log aggregators can join request lines with the response sent to the client. The log level defaults to `info` and can be overridden in state: `#{level => debug | info | notice | ...}`. """. -behaviour(livery_middleware). -export([call/3]). -doc "Run the handler and log one entry on the way out.". -spec call(livery_req:req(), livery_middleware:next(), map()) -> livery_resp:resp(). call(Req, Next, State) -> Start = erlang:monotonic_time(microsecond), Resp = Next(Req), Elapsed = erlang:monotonic_time(microsecond) - Start, Level = maps:get(level, State, info), logger:log(Level, #{ msg => "livery_access", protocol => livery_req:protocol(Req), method => sanitize(livery_req:method(Req)), path => sanitize(livery_req:path(Req)), status => livery_resp:status(Resp), duration_us => Elapsed, request_id => livery_req:req_id(Req) }), Resp. %% Replace control bytes (including CR/LF) in attacker-controlled fields %% so a crafted path/method cannot forge extra log lines. -spec sanitize(binary()) -> binary(). sanitize(Bin) when is_binary(Bin) -> << <<(control_to_space(B))>> || <> <= Bin >>. -spec control_to_space(byte()) -> byte(). control_to_space(B) when B < 32; B =:= 127 -> $\s; control_to_space(B) -> B.
